Transaction 1aef6c7d40bb8e753ef9fe68dc33d7fcf89a3ec424575af7821874339a352960
1 Input
1 Output
-
1aef6c7d40bb8e753ef9fe68dc33d7fcf89a3ec424575af7821874339a352960:0
- value
- 842661
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83002fe3dad495441386235833776349ae73887e OP_EQUAL
- address
- 3DdgfftwFX7kLzzQjRgasTDcHgPvn2JM1u